Executive Summary
Barclays offers a Tiered Savings account with a competitive 4.00% APY for balances over $250,000, while lower balances earn 3.85%. The account has no maintenance fees and does not require direct deposit, making it an attractive option for those with significant savings. Additionally, Barclays provides an Online Savings account with a 3.60% APY, ideal for those seeking simplicity. In contrast, Charles Schwab Bank's Schwab Bank Investor Savings™ has a much lower APY of 0.15%, but it allows for smaller deposits with no minimum balance requirement. Overall, Barclays stands out as the winner based on the higher APY offered.
